On the egosoft forum Paul Wheeler who did make the mod, did say about that problem:
"The only thing that causes mammoths everywhere is a conflicting tships. Possible reasons are:
1 - youre not deleting the bounce cat/dat after generating your wall file.
2 - you are not starting a new game after removing the bounce cat/dat.
3 - your cat/dats are not consecutively numbered.
4 - you have another mod which has a tships in it.
Whatever the cause, the game cannot see the XRM tships. "

1. I didn't delete everything in my addon folder. I deleted the folders mov,scripts, t, types, and director. I figured anything else in there should be fine.
2. I went through all my cat/dat files and deleted the ones that were not the original vanilla files.
3. I went in to the games steam properties and did an integrity check to get all the original files reinstalled.
4. Now, I began the process of reinstallation of XRM. I read and reread the installation process and addendae below that for additional Mods with regards to compatibility. I would like to note two major things I did that I think were both causing issues.
4.1 MAKE SURE YOU HAVE THE LATEST HULL PACKS!!! To elaborate, I have installed XRM before. Thus, I have some old files that I ignorantly thought would be OK. They are most likely not! Be sure to download the latest files even if you think your files look the same.
4.2 If you use MARS like I do, make sure you DO NOT use the cat/dat files from MARS for the repair drones. They are already included in XRM. XRM provides a link further down for a download of MARS with just the bare essentials you need to run it on XRM. There is also an additional file earlier on in the installation reading that you need to run MARS in case you missed it.
5. I installed complex cleaner. Note, this must be installed with the cat/dat loaded BEFORE XRM.
6. I installed various other mods that have no cat/dat.
I hope this helps others who encounter this problem in the future. Make you you are awake, patient, and meticulous in your methods before attempting installation. READ the installation document over, then read it again.
